QCameraFocusZoneList BbCameraFocusControl::focusZones() const
{
    if (m_session->state() == QCamera::UnloadedState)
        return QCameraFocusZoneList();

    camera_region_t regions[20];
    int supported = 0;
    int asked = 0;
    camera_error_t result = camera_get_focus_regions(m_session->handle(), 20, &supported, &asked, regions);

    if (result != CAMERA_EOK) {
        qWarning() << "Unable to retrieve focus regions:" << result;
        return QCameraFocusZoneList();
    }

    // retrieve width and height of viewfinder
    int viewfinderWidth = 0;
    int viewfinderHeight = 0;
    if (m_session->captureMode() & QCamera::CaptureStillImage)
        result = camera_get_photovf_property(m_session->handle(),
                                             CAMERA_IMGPROP_WIDTH, &viewfinderWidth,
                                             CAMERA_IMGPROP_HEIGHT, &viewfinderHeight);
    else if (m_session->captureMode() & QCamera::CaptureVideo)
        result = camera_get_videovf_property(m_session->handle(),
                                             CAMERA_IMGPROP_WIDTH, &viewfinderWidth,
                                             CAMERA_IMGPROP_HEIGHT, &viewfinderHeight);

    if (result != CAMERA_EOK) {
        qWarning() << "Unable to retrieve viewfinder size:" << result;
        return QCameraFocusZoneList();
    }

    QCameraFocusZoneList list;
    for (int i = 0; i < asked; ++i) {
        const int x = regions[i].left;
        const int y = regions[i].top;
        const int width = regions[i].width;
        const int height = regions[i].height;

        QRectF rect(static_cast<float>(x)/static_cast<float>(viewfinderWidth),
                    static_cast<float>(y)/static_cast<float>(viewfinderHeight),
                    static_cast<float>(width)/static_cast<float>(viewfinderWidth),
                    static_cast<float>(height)/static_cast<float>(viewfinderHeight));

        list << QCameraFocusZone(rect, QCameraFocusZone::Focused); //TODO: how to know if a zone is unused/selected/focused?!?
    }

    return list;
}

/*!
  \property QCameraFocus::focusZones

  Returns the list of active focus zones.

  If QCamera::FocusPointAuto or QCamera::FocusPointFaceDetection focus mode is selected
  this method returns the list of zones the camera is actually focused on.

  The coordinates system is the same as for custom focus points:
  QPointF(0,0) points to the left top frame point, QPointF(0.5,0.5) points to the frame center.
 */
QCameraFocusZoneList QCameraFocus::focusZones() const
{
    return d_func()->focusControl ?
            d_func()->focusControl->focusZones() :
            QCameraFocusZoneList();
}
